libheif is a HEIF and AVIF file format decoder and encoder. Prior to version 1.22.0, `Track::init_sample_timing_table()` in `libheif/sequences/track.cc` stores an out-of-bounds chunk index (`m_chunks.size()`) into `m_presentation_timeline` when the number of chunks defined in the `stco` box is less than the number of samples in `stsz`. A subsequent call to `heif_track_get_next_raw_sequence_sample()` reads `m_chunks[chunk_idx]` with that OOB index, causing a heap-buffer-overflow. Version 1.22.0 fixes the issue.
